ПРОЕКТЫ 


  АРХИВ 


Apache-Talk @lexa.ru 

Inet-Admins @info.east.ru 

Filmscanners @halftone.co.uk 

Security-alerts @yandex-team.ru 

nginx-ru @sysoev.ru 

  СТАТЬИ 


  ПЕРСОНАЛЬНОЕ 


  ПРОГРАММЫ 



ПИШИТЕ
ПИСЬМА














     АРХИВ :: Apache-Talk
Apache-Talk mailing list archive (apache-talk@lists.lexa.ru)

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[apache-talk] mod_accel + cookie



> > А чем не нравится просто выставлять заголовки Expires и Pragma, чтобы
> > контент вообще не кешировался?
>
> Так оно сейчас и работает. Но если, скажем, довольно большая страница
> генерится одинаково для группы пользователей и меняется 1 раз в месяц, то
> зачем ее генерить каждый хит? Она разная для разных групп пользователей,
но
> в пределах группы ее очень хорошо можно закэшировать. Также много страниц
> (их большинство), контент которых статичен достаточно долгое время для
> каждого отдельно взятого пользователя, но при этом они довольно накладные
в
> смысле генерирования контента.

Ну IMHO лучще все таки все не кешировать в данном случае, а иначе из-за всех
премудростей все таки пользователи могут получать либо старые документы,
либо документы не для них. У кого то время на компе может стоять не
правильно, у кого то куки отключены.

> > > Авторизация через куки.
> > >
> > > Можно ли в этом случае как-то прикрутить акселератор ? Переписывать
все
> на
> > > предмет таскания cookie_user_id через URL сильно не хочется.
> >
> > У меня все через куки и стоит mod_accel. Главное, чтобы скрипты вместе с
> > куки выставляли заголовки Expires или/и Pragma: no-cache. Тогда
mod_accel
> не
> > будет кешировать такие документы.
>
> См выше. Надо чтобы значение определенной куки участвовало как бы в URL
> документа. Может быть mod_rewrite поможет?

Дак в mod_accel есть опция, чтобы куки учавствовала в URL при кешировании.

> Сергей

Алексей

=============================================================================
=               Apache-Talk@lists.lexa.ru mailing list                      =
Mail "unsubscribe apache-talk" to majordomo@lists.lexa.ru if you want to quit.
=       Archive avaliable at http://www.lexa.ru/apache-talk                 =



 




Copyright © Lexa Software, 1996-2009.